The global Bowling Centers Market is projected to reach a value of USD 16.8 billion by 2032, growing at a CAGR of 4.5% from its estimated size of USD 11.2 billion in 2023. Increasing consumer demand for immersive leisure experiences and modernized sports facilities is significantly driving the growth of the bowling industry worldwide.

The market is witnessing a revival as bowling transforms from a traditional sport into a modern-day entertainment solution. The incorporation of technology, themed events, and food & beverage services has boosted its appeal among millennials, families, and corporate groups alike.

Market Drivers: Tech Innovation and Social Entertainment

One of the primary growth drivers for bowling centers is technological innovation. Centers equipped with automated scoring systems, interactive displays, and augmented reality (AR) lanes are attracting a wider demographic. Modern consumers expect more than just a game—they seek a fully integrated experience.

Additionally, bowling is increasingly viewed as a social recreational activity. It’s a popular choice for birthday parties, corporate team-building events, and weekend family outings. This positions bowling centers as dynamic entertainment hubs rather than just sporting venues.

Market Restraints: High Operational Costs and Space Constraints

Despite the promising outlook, the market faces key challenges. High real estate and operational costs, especially in urban areas, can limit expansion efforts for new entrants. The cost of maintaining modern lanes, tech systems, and ambiance-enhancing elements can be burdensome for small-scale operators.

Moreover, space constraints in densely populated cities make it difficult to set up full-scale bowling centers. This has led to a trend of mini-bowling installations in arcades and malls, which may offer limited experiences compared to traditional centers.

Market Opportunities: Emerging Markets and Niche Segmentation

On the upside, emerging economies in Asia-Pacific and Latin America present lucrative opportunities. As disposable incomes rise and urban lifestyles evolve, the demand for family entertainment is gaining traction. Bowling centers that tailor experiences to local cultures and preferences stand to gain a competitive edge.

Niche segmentation—like boutique bowling lounges, glow-in-the-dark lanes, and competitive league formats—also opens up new growth avenues. Operators are increasingly focusing on theme-based and experience-driven bowling environments to attract specific target groups.


Noteworthy Trends and Insights

  • Family-Oriented Entertainment: Centers offering combined activities such as bowling, arcade games, and dining are gaining popularity.

  • Boutique Bowling Lanes: Upscale and compact bowling concepts with premium services are making waves in metropolitan areas.

  • League and Tournament Growth: Organized bowling leagues are being revitalized, increasing participation and engagement.

  • Digital Integration: Mobile apps for booking, scoring, and loyalty programs are enhancing customer convenience and retention.

Regional Outlook: North America Leads, Asia-Pacific on the Rise

North America currently holds the largest market share due to a well-established bowling culture and the presence of advanced entertainment venues. However, the Asia-Pacific region is poised for the fastest growth, fueled by increasing urbanization, rising youth population, and expanding middle-class income.

Europe remains steady, with family-oriented entertainment seeing renewed interest post-pandemic. Additionally, Middle Eastern countries are investing in leisure infrastructure, further supporting global market expansion.


Segment Breakdown: Center Type, Age Group, and Revenue Source

The market is segmented by center type (traditional, boutique, hybrid), target audience (children, adults, families), and revenue stream (games, food & beverages, events). Boutique bowling lounges are expected to witness the highest CAGR, due to their high-margin models and appeal to upscale audiences.

Meanwhile, family segments continue to dominate footfall, accounting for over 40% of total visits in 2024. Revenue from food and beverages also plays a significant role, often comprising up to 35% of a center’s income.
